Incorporating Bright Colors into Your Home
Ready to add some pizzazz to your winter abode? Here are some ways to incorporate your bright winter color palette into your home:
Living Room
Start by adding a bright area rug or throw pillows in your chosen colors. Then, layer in more color with artwork, vases, or decorative objects. For a bold statement, consider painting an accent wall or investing in a vibrant piece of furniture.
Kitchen
Brighten up your kitchen with colorful dishes, appliances, or cabinet hardware. You could also paint your kitchen island or backsplash in a bold hue for a striking focal point.

Bedroom
Create a cozy, vibrant retreat with bright bedding, curtains, or wall art. Don't forget to add some color with your clothing and accessories, too – your wardrobe is an extension of your home decor!
